While talking to a little girl in his store, Ben gets defensive about his horseshoe tossing abilities. It seems that rumors have it that his friend, and choir partner, Eli has laid claim to being tops at horseshoes. Soon, the party lines are all buzzing with the news of sore feelings. As the group arrives will the singing soothe the hurt emotions?

After uneasy conversation, Cliff and Alice sing a duet. Ben and Eli act like pouting little boys before a solo of an Irish Ballad.

The ladies take charge, and have the group play house. Through role playing, they make their point. A tournament is planned to settle the argument, and a final hymn is sung. Blessed Be the Tie that Binds. The lesson is learned, you always hurt the ones you love.
